Standard Pneumatic Shear Apparatus: Direct Machine
The Standard Pneumatic Direct Shear Apparatus is designed for precise determination of direct and residual shear strength in soils. This system includes a high-capacity load cell with digital readout to accurately measure shear load up to 1,500 lbf (6.67 kN), along with dial indicators for consolidation and shear displacement measurements. It is ideal for laboratories performing standardized shear testing and advanced geotechnical analysis.
Shear displacement testing evaluates the shear strength of consolidated drained and undrained soil samples, providing critical data for assessing soil stability and structural performance. Soil specimens—either undisturbed or remolded—are trimmed and placed into a Direct Shear Box, which is split horizontally to allow independent movement of the upper and lower halves. During testing, a vertical confining load is applied, followed by a controlled horizontal shear force. After failure, the shear direction can be reversed to determine residual shear values.
Pneumatic Loading & Control System
This tabletop unit uses Certified MTP’s patented CONBEL® Pneumatic Loading System to apply accurate and repeatable vertical loads without the need for dead weights. Two pneumatic pistons apply loads ranging from 4 to 1,500 lbf, enhancing sensitivity at low pressures while maintaining accuracy at higher loads. Load adjustments are controlled through a precision regulator and displayed digitally with an accuracy of ±0.25%.
The front panel features manual valve controls and a digital display, allowing users to easily monitor and adjust test conditions in real time. A stepper motor drive precisely controls strain rates from 0.0001 to 0.3 in/min, ensuring compliance with standardized testing procedures.
Data Acquisition & Software Integration
For advanced automation and reporting, this system is compatible with NEXT Software, enabling real-time monitoring, automated test control, and professional report generation. Independent data acquisition channels capture vertical and horizontal deformation data, which can be stored indefinitely or exported in CSV format for further analysis.
Engineers can conduct tests in stand-alone mode or integrate the machine with a LAN-connected computer for centralized data management, making it suitable for high-volume laboratory environments.
Included Components & Standards Compliance
The system includes a 2.5in stainless steel shear ring, porous stones, drainage plates, and a corrosion-resistant water chamber constructed from Teflon-coated anodized aluminum. Optional accessories such as counter-balance devices and additional porous stones are available separately through Certified MTP Geotechnical Accessories.
Electrical: 110V / 60Hz
Standards: Meets ASTM D3080 and AASHTO T236
